Output f224a61ac18f10101d5d5c7821d4b72a58d0a87f63cc80df7b33cfd18ca4ba7c:7

value
1563000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2076aae564d9f2ae335fd3c3c208789ba10b66f3 OP_EQUAL
address
34efhrCkL6kabujc5LKGyjpskVqBW8QUgf
transaction
f224a61ac18f10101d5d5c7821d4b72a58d0a87f63cc80df7b33cfd18ca4ba7c
confirmations
203940
spent
true